Uploaded image for project: 'Observability Documentation'
  1. Observability Documentation
  2. OBSDOCS-432

Documentation updates for changes to topology spread constraints for monitoring

XMLWordPrintable

    • OBSDOCS (Apr 15 - May 6) #252

      Monitoring has changed so that the Topology Spread Constraints (TSC) feature is exposed for all pods. The current structure with TSC documented for each component (Promethues, Alertmanager, Thanos Ruler) does not scale.

      TSC for monitoring components are currently documented in the following location, with each component receiving individual treatment:
      https://docs.openshift.com/container-platform/4.13/monitoring/configuring-the-monitoring-stack.html#configuring_pod_topology_spread_constraintsfor_monitoring_configuring-the-monitoring-stack

      OCP core docs also include general TSC content here:
      https://docs.openshift.com/container-platform/4.13/nodes/scheduling/nodes-scheduler-pod-topology-spread-constraints.html#nodes-scheduler-pod-topology-spread-constraints-about

      We need to update the TSC docs for monitoring to reflect that TSC now applies to all pods. We should make the instructions for monitoring TSC generic in the same way that we approach the docs for tolerations:

      https://docs.openshift.com/container-platform/4.13/monitoring/configuring-the-monitoring-stack.html#assigning-tolerations-to-monitoring-components_configuring-the-monitoring-stack

              eromanov@redhat.com Eliska Romanova
              jfajersk@redhat.com Jan Fajerski
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: